Instead, it teaches the cross-cutting domains and gives you **curated search phrases** that map to `aiwg discover` lookups, plus a list of which framework-specific quickrefs are loaded. ## How to use this quickref Walk the action hierarchy in order. The agent always prefers a **skill** over a raw CLI invocation: 1. **Priority 1 — Local skill or agent**: check if a skill already in your context handles the need (kernel skills listed below, framework quickrefs, deployed agents like `aiwg-steward` / `aiwg-finder`). These cost nothing to invoke. 2. **Priority 2 — Discovered skill**: if no local match, pick a **curated phrase** from a capability domain (or paraphrase the user's words), run `aiwg discover ""`, surface the top match, and fetch its body with `aiwg show ` — never `find` / `ls` / `Read`. 3. **Priority 3 — Raw CLI**: only when no skill exists at priorities 1 or 2, OR the command is on the discovery surface (`aiwg discover`, `aiwg show`, `aiwg list`, `aiwg version`, `aiwg runtime-info`), OR you are inside a skill that's calling the CLI as its step. **Do not enumerate skills from memory.** AIWG ships hundreds of skills; you only see the kernel set in your context. See the [`cli-secondary` rule](../../rules/cli-secondary.md) for the full hierarchy and per-command pairings. ## The canonical pipeline: `discover → show` Most AIWG skills (~385 of 400) are **not in your context** and are not in `/skills/` either — they stay at `$AIWG_ROOT` (no per-project copy by default, #1217). Two commands close the loop: ```bash # 1. Find — returns ranked candidates with absolute paths aiwg discover "" # 2. Fetch — streams the SKILL.md body for the chosen candidate aiwg show skill # or: agent | command | rule ``` `discover` and `show` are designed to compose. **You should never need to navigate the filesystem to read AIWG content.** That's the whole point of the CLI. ### When the platform Skill tool errors Most AIWG skills aren't kernel-listed, so the platform's Skill tool will reject them. This is expected behavior, not a bug. The fallback hierarchy: 1. **`aiwg show `** — primary fetch. Always works regardless of kernel status. 2. **`aiwg show --json`** — same fetch with `{ path, content }` envelope, useful for forwarding to a sub-agent. 3. **Read directly from `$AIWG_ROOT/agentic/code/`** — last-resort fallback. Only if the `aiwg` CLI itself is broken. The corpus at `$AIWG_ROOT/agentic/code/frameworks//skills//SKILL.md` and `$AIWG_ROOT/agentic/code/addons//skills//SKILL.md` is the canonical source — it is always present at the install root and survives any deploy-state corruption. **Forbidden after `discover` returns a path**: running `find`, `ls`, `Glob`, or `Read` on a `/skills/` directory. Those reflect the kernel-pivot deploy state, not the full surface. Use `aiwg show`. This is mandated by the `skill-discovery` HIGH rule. They have no paired "priming skill" because they ARE the priming entry points. ### Status intent disambiguation Route these phrases carefully: | User intent | Use | |---|---| | Workspace inventory, installed frameworks, deployed provider files | `aiwg-status` / `aiwg status` | | Cross-framework project progress, "project-status", "where are we?", "what is next?" | `aiwg discover "project status"` → `aiwg show skill project-status --first` | | SDLC-specific project health or lifecycle gate status | `aiwg discover "SDLC project health check"` and prefer `project-health-check` or `orchestrate-project` when those rank above generic workspace inventory | Do not answer `project-status` by running only `aiwg status`; that command reports workspace install/deployment inventory, not project progress. When a user wants to **file an AIWG product issue or open an AIWG delivery PR**, route them through `aiwg-issue` / `aiwg-pr` (or the explicit alias `aiwg-delivery-pr`) first. These are AIWG-specific kernel skills and reference `steward-prep-delivery` where applicable. For generic repository PR work, use ordinary repository PR tooling and templates. Examples: "open a PR for this repo" → normal git/Gitea/GitHub PR flow; "open an AIWG delivery PR for this change" → `aiwg-pr`. `aiwg-*` skills are AIWG-specific product/workspace capabilities. Do not route general tracker processing through `aiwg-issue`: use `issue-audit` / `audit-issues` for backlog audits and `address-issues` for implementation loops. When a user wants to **start using issues for their own project**, especially local file-system backed issues, route them to the `issue-workflow-guide` agent or discover/show it if it is not already loaded. The guide helps choose local vs external tracker backends, suggests a project-specific issue key prefix, and explains how local issues feed `issue-audit` and `address-issues`.
